Detailed Product Review

The UCFC 204 pillow block bearing unit is a high-performance 4-bolt square flange cast iron housing bearing unit, designed for industrial automation and machine manufacturing sectors, particularly for applications requiring small and compact shaft diameters. This specific design is optimized for a 20 mm nominal shaft diameter. Thanks to the spherical outer ring structure of the integrated UC 204 insert bearing, it can effectively tolerate minor misalignment or eccentricities between the shaft and the bearing housing. This self-aligning capability minimizes localized stress concentrations on the bearing elements, preventing premature fatigue failures and increasing the bearing’s dynamic load-carrying capacity. The square flange housing geometry provides a robust four-point fixation to flat mounting surfaces, offering superior rigidity and stability against operational vibrations, which directly impacts shaft rotational stability and positioning accuracy.

The cast iron housing of the product is engineered from high-strength cast iron, specifically designed for heavy-duty conditions, high vibration, and impact-prone operating environments. The inherent damping properties of cast iron reduce the transmission of dynamic loads and vibrations from the machine to the bearing elements, thereby extending the overall mechanical life of the system. The integrated grease nipple allows for periodic lubrication, reducing the friction coefficient between the inner ring and rolling elements, increasing wear resistance, and significantly extending the product’s total service life. When correct mounting procedures, bolt torque values, and regular maintenance protocols are followed, the UCFC 204 pillow block bearing unit provides years of reliable and high-performance service, directly contributing to the continuity and efficiency of your production processes. The standard sealing structure protects the bearing’s internal components in dusty, chip-filled, and dirty industrial environments, reinforcing operational reliability.

UCFC 204 Pillow Block Bearing Unit Advantages

Mechanical Optimization with Precise Shaft Diameter Compatibility (20 mm): This bearing unit is designed with precise tolerances for a 20 mm nominal shaft diameter. This engineering detail is configured to ensure an optimal fit between the shaft and the bearing’s inner ring. Consequently, radial and axial clearances that may occur during the shaft’s rotational movements are minimized, reducing system vibration amplitudes and enhancing rotational stability. This precise fit plays a critical role in maintaining processing quality and machine longevity, especially in compact mechanisms requiring high speeds or precise positioning.

High Rigidity and Impact Resistance with Cast Iron Housing: The housing of the UCFC 204 is manufactured from high-strength cast iron. Cast iron is a material with high internal damping capacity, capable of absorbing vibration energy generated under operational loads. This feature ensures the structural integrity of the bearing unit, particularly in industrial environments where impact loads or high-frequency vibrations are present. High rigidity ensures minimal deformation at the shaft’s bearing point, while impact resistance enhances mechanical durability against sudden load changes, thereby extending the life of machine components.

Eccentricity Tolerance with Spherical Outer Ring Design: The outer ring of the UC 204 bearing within the UCFC 204 features a spherical geometry. This design offers the ability to automatically compensate for minor angular misalignments or eccentricities that may occur during installation or under operational loads between the bearing housing and the shaft. This self-aligning feature reduces localized stress concentrations on the bearing elements, extends bearing life, and prevents premature failures due to overload. Furthermore, it simplifies the installation process, reducing setup time and minimizing system stresses that could arise from potential mounting errors.

Technical Frequently Asked Questions (FAQ)

What specific mechanical advantages does the spherical outer ring design of the UCFC 204 pillow block bearing offer for the system’s overall service life and performance?

The spherical outer ring structure of the UC 204 bearing within the UCFC 204 provides the capability to dynamically compensate for angular misalignments or eccentricities that may occur between the bearing housing and the inner ring. This feature prevents localized stress concentrations on the bearing elements, which can arise from shaft and bearing center deviations during installation or when the machine chassis flexes under operational loads. In standard, non-self-aligning bearings, such misalignments can lead to uneven load distribution across the balls and raceways, causing premature fatigue and wear. With the spherical outer ring, the load is distributed more uniformly among the bearing elements, which increases the bearing’s dynamic load-carrying capacity and ultimately significantly extends the bearing’s nominal service life. Furthermore, this design contributes to energy efficiency by minimizing frictional losses within the system and ensures quieter operation.
